Overview[]
The AK-47 Origin is the first AK-47 skin to ever be added to the game, and one of the first 4 Rifles to ever be in the game. Compared to the AK-47's we have today, it is very hard to control, has low damage and is overall an outdated weapon. Although, it is unique in that it has the most mods of any AK-47 in the game.
